Lubbock, get ready for a Saturday packed with heart, hope, and home runs! LifeGift is inviting the entire West Texas community to its very first HopeFest, happening Saturday, August 9th, from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. at the Texas Tech Recreational Softball Fields.

Honoring Donors

This free, family-friendly celebration is all about honoring organ, eye, and tissue donors while raising awareness for the more than 10,000 Texans still waiting for a second chance at life through transplant.

And this isn’t just a solemn tribute — it’s a celebration!

Softball, Snow Cones & Saving Lives

One of the event’s biggest highlights? A Softball Showdown between Lubbock healthcare giants Covenant Health and University Medical Center, complete with awards for Best Uniform, Best Team Name, and of course, the Championship Trophy. Let’s just say — bragging rights are on the line.

Attendees can walk the moving Honor Path, created by donor families to pay tribute to those who gave the ultimate gift. And the kids? They’ll be having a blast with face painting, a photo booth, DJ with TJ, and hands-on activities.

Covenant Children’s medical helicopter will land on-site, and the Lubbock Police Department will showcase their sleek motor units — so bring your cameras!

Hungry? Local food trucks will be serving up ballpark classics like hot dogs, burgers, nachos, and snow cones.

Give Blood, Give Life

Vitalant will have a mobile blood donation unit on-site — and yes, every donor gets a gift. Appointments are encouraged and can be made through LifeGift’s HopeFest website.

HopeFest 2025 is sponsored by a who’s who of community partners, including Covenant Health, UMC, H-E-B, Coca-Cola Southwest Beverages, Lubbock Chamber of Commerce, South Plains Kidney Foundation, and many more.

“HopeFest is about celebrating life and raising awareness,” Kevin Myer, President & CEO of LifeGift said via press release. “Lubbock’s overwhelming support proves how deeply this community cares.”
